summaryrefslogtreecommitdiff
path: root/simplex/bootswatch.less
diff options
context:
space:
mode:
authorThomas Park <thomas@thomaspark.me>2012-08-30 10:29:07 -0400
committerThomas Park <thomas@thomaspark.me>2012-08-30 10:29:07 -0400
commitd4e7d3f04894d308c2278002012fccb6de09b610 (patch)
treeeb7e084d0d7f8178827ff3c4b4d258e909d92f73 /simplex/bootswatch.less
parentc47bd572e125009f4fd81a8ee3c419d66f0d83ad (diff)
all: change how nav-collapse is styled to use a media query
Diffstat (limited to 'simplex/bootswatch.less')
-rwxr-xr-xsimplex/bootswatch.less105
1 files changed, 20 insertions, 85 deletions
diff --git a/simplex/bootswatch.less b/simplex/bootswatch.less
index 30cd90ad..5917fc8f 100755
--- a/simplex/bootswatch.less
+++ b/simplex/bootswatch.less
@@ -76,31 +76,21 @@ hr {
font-family: @headingsFontFamily;
}
- .nav li.dropdown.open > .dropdown-toggle,
- .nav li.dropdown.active > .dropdown-toggle:hover {
- color: @linkColor;
- }
+ &-inverse {
- .nav li.dropdown .dropdown-toggle .caret {
- border-top-color: @textColor;
- border-bottom-color: @textColor;
- opacity: 1;
- }
+ .navbar-inner {
+ .box-shadow(none);
+ }
- .nav li.dropdown .dropdown-toggle:hover .caret,
- .nav li.dropdown.active > .dropdown-toggle .caret,
- .nav li.dropdown.open .dropdown-toggle .caret {
- border-top-color: @linkColor;
- border-bottom-color: @linkColor;
+ .brand:hover {
+ color: @white;
+ }
}
+}
- .nav > .active > a,
- .nav > .active > a:hover,
- .nav > .active > a:focus {
- // .box-shadow(none);
- }
+@media (max-width: @navbarCollapseWidth) {
- .nav-collapse.collapse {
+ .navbar .nav-collapse {
.nav li > a {
color: @textColor;
@@ -111,6 +101,9 @@ hr {
}
}
+ .nav .active > a {
+ .box-shadow(none);
+ }
.navbar-form,
.navbar-search {
@@ -119,41 +112,18 @@ hr {
}
}
- &-inverse {
-
- .navbar-inner {
- .box-shadow(none);
- }
+ .navbar-inverse .nav-collapse {
- .brand:hover {
- color: @white;
- }
-
- .nav li.dropdown.open .dropdown-toggle {
+ .nav li > a {
color: @white;
- }
- .nav li.dropdown .dropdown-toggle .caret,
- .nav li.dropdown .dropdown-toggle:hover .caret,
- .nav li.dropdown.active .dropdown-toggle .caret,
- .nav li.dropdown.open .dropdown-toggle .caret {
- border-top-color: @white;
- border-bottom-color: @white;
- }
-
- .nav-collapse.collapse {
-
- .nav li > a {
- color: @white;
-
- &:hover {
- background-color: rgba(255, 255, 255, 0.1);
- }
+ &:hover {
+ background-color: rgba(255, 255, 255, 0.1) !important;
}
+ }
- .nav-header {
- color: rgba(255, 255, 255, 0.7);
- }
+ .nav-header {
+ color: rgba(255, 255, 255, 0.7);
}
}
}
@@ -190,32 +160,6 @@ div.subnav {
.box-shadow(none);
color: @linkColor;
}
-
- .nav > li.dropdown.open > a,
- .nav > li.dropdown.open > a:hover {
- border-left-color: transparent;
- border-right-color: transparent;
- background-color: transparent;
- color: @linkColor;
- }
-
- .nav li.dropdown .dropdown-toggle .caret {
- border-top-color: @textColor;
- border-bottom-color: @textColor;
- opacity: 1;
- }
-
- .nav li.dropdown .dropdown-toggle:hover .caret,
- .nav li.dropdown.active .dropdown-toggle .caret,
- .nav li.dropdown.open .dropdown-toggle .caret {
- border-top-color: @linkColor;
- border-bottom-color: @linkColor;
- opacity: 1;
- }
-
- .dropdown.open:hover .dropdown-toggle {
- background-color: transparent;
- }
}
// NAV
@@ -492,12 +436,3 @@ i[class^="icon-"]{
// MEDIA QUERIES
// -----------------------------------------------------
-
-@media (max-width: 979px) {
-
- .nav-collapse.collapse .navbar-form,
- .nav-collapse.collapse .navbar-search {
- border-top: 1px solid @grayLighter;
- border-bottom: 1px solid @grayLighter;
- }
-}